之前介绍了DOcker的web管理工具DockerUI,下面介绍下Docker的另一个web界面管理工具Shipyard的使用。Shipyard(github)是建立在docker集群管理工具Citadel之上的可以管理容器、主机等资源的web图形化工具,包括core和extension两个版本,c ...
分类:
Web程序 时间:
2018-01-03 13:55:40
阅读次数:
486
也是基于cni网络, 1.替代了kube proxy组件,无需在部署kube router,解决了svc网络 2.自带cni,bgp,解决了pod网络 3.基于ipvs转发 4.路由传播依赖bgp kuberouter结构 参考(部署步骤): https://cloudnativelabs.gith ...
分类:
其他好文 时间:
2018-01-02 19:58:05
阅读次数:
1683
通过http://api:8080/api/v1/namespaces/default/services/mynginx/proxy/ 通过svc访问集群报错 我想通过类似这种模式来访问我的集群 本来应该是这样子 结果报错了 master节点为何要跑flannel? 最终查明,本质原因在于maste ...
分类:
Windows程序 时间:
2018-01-02 16:45:39
阅读次数:
1311
dashboard最终效果 多了执行sh的窗口 heapster+influxdb+grafana搭建 整个架构是 dashboard去检测 hepster service服务, heapster通过cadvisor搜集到数据入库到influxdb. 而dashboard访问heapster的svc ...
分类:
数据库 时间:
2018-01-02 15:26:40
阅读次数:
297
角色|节点名|节点ip | | master| n1 |192.168.14.11 节点1 |n2 |192.168.14.12 节点2 |n3 |192.168.14.13 https://raw.githubusercontent.com/lannyMa/scripts/master/k8s/ ...
分类:
其他好文 时间:
2018-01-01 11:25:54
阅读次数:
516
kubelet单组件启动静态pod 无需k8s其他组件,单独下载kubelet的二进制,可以启动静态pod. 静态pod不受api管理,kubectl get po可以看到,但是kubectl delete pod 删除后,出去pending状态, 节点容器并没有删除,要想删除,去节点操作kubel ...
分类:
其他好文 时间:
2017-12-30 21:27:02
阅读次数:
230
结构图: API server 是中心. scheduler 源码分析. $ git ls-files |grep scheduler |less 可以看到 scheduler 的主要目录,有cmd, algorithm, api ... 可以猜出来这个文件是干啥的. cmd是 就是command吗 ...
分类:
Web程序 时间:
2017-12-29 17:23:08
阅读次数:
172
这里的etcd集群复用我们测试的3个节点,3个node都要安装并启动,注意修改配置文件 1、TLS认证文件分发:etcd集群认证用,除了本机有,分发到其他node节点 2、安装Etcd,这里使用的yum安装方式 若使用yum安装,默认etcd命令将在/usr/bin目录下,注意修改下面的etcd.s ...
分类:
Web程序 时间:
2017-12-29 15:06:40
阅读次数:
1567
linux namespace&bridge通俗演义 linux接口类型 br0 eth0: 一个接口 veth : 一对接口,类似一跟网线,一头有地址,另一头连到别处, linux 2个namespace连通 不同namespace是隔离的. 想让他们通,需要用网线连起来(veth类型口,一头给n ...
分类:
系统相关 时间:
2017-12-28 13:53:10
阅读次数:
197